Crypto-Currencies: Ripple Better than Bitcoin !

in #bitcoin7 years ago

The most visible is not always the best performer. In 2017, the Ripple is better than Bitcoin. Admittedly, the year 2017 has probably been that of Bitcoin: the most popular and high-profile cryptocurrency has grown from just over $ 900 in early 2017 to nearly $ 17,000 in December. Not without playing the roller coaster at the end of the year, causing some observers to fear the explosion of a "speculative bubble". But the Ripple has grown 36,000% in one year, against 1,318% for Bitcoin.

More than 36,000% increase in one year. Who says better ? The Ripple, discreet cryptocurrency, was much better in 2017 than the highly publicized Bitcoin. It jumped 36,000% in one year, from a value of 0.0064 dollars in January 2017 to 2.90 dollars today. The US site Quartz has made the list of the most successful crypto-currencies in 2017, with the Ripple in first place, far ahead of Bitcoin, only 14th in this ranking performance.

The Ripple has also just dethroned the Ethereum from second place in terms of market capitalization. With $ 112,325,700,050 in market capitalization, the Ripple is just behind Bitcoin and its 254,094,585,322, and in front of the Ethereum and its $ 86,050,389,365, according to CoinMarketCap (January 3) .

Yet Bitcoin is worth more than a Ripple - $ 15 143 for Bitcoin against 2.90 for the Ripple on January 3, 2018.

"People feel comfortable with their name and the technology behind the Ripple," says Forbes.com Trevor Koverko, CEO of Polymath, a blockchain platform that allows start-ups to launch their own crypto -change. "Ripple is the first winner here," he adds. According to our colleague from Forbes, the increase is largely due to Asian speculators. Cryptocurrency investors believe that Asia accounts for at least a third of all trading volumes in digital currency, including Japan, South Korea, and China via Hong Kong. Unlike other crypto-currencies, the Ripple is less volatile because Ripple Labs owns two-thirds.

Launched in 2012, four years after Bitcoin, the Ripple is better known for its digital payment protocol than for its virtual currency (XRP), says Les Echos. Financial institutions like UBS, UniCredit or SAP have adopted it because cross-border transactions made in Ripples are instantaneous, recalls the daily. However, Bitcoin transactions take more and more time and cost $ 15, regardless of the amount. Ripple is now headed by Brad Garlinghouse who has held senior management positions at AOL and Yahoo! between 2003 and 2012.

Towards a regulation?

While it is unlikely (despite Yoyo year-end) that the Ripple supplants Bitcoin as this virtual currency has generated enthusiasm in 2017, some concerns emerge. The interest they arouse increases more or less at the same speed as the fear of a cryptocurrency bubble. And with the craze and worry comes the idea of ​​regulation. "These virtual currencies raise the suspicion of everything that is organized and regulated," said David Benichou, CEO of Via.io and expert in cryptocurrencies, last December in Forbes France. "The basic paradigm of cryptocurrencies is precisely this: less centralization, less regulation and more power in the hands of users. "

The Bank of England understands this and is working, according to The Telegraph, on a pound-denominated digital currency project under the Bank of England. What combine flexibility of cryptocurrency and control of financial authority. And shake the very unstable virtual currencies.
